Got a quick load setup with 220LRHT and verified drops at 700yds. I am hoping to take a big cull buck(or several) but today I made a quick shot on a large running boar.
impact velocity was 2700fps. Entry was in the neck just below the ear angling back into the shoulder.
.308 entrance with a dime hole in muscle just below skin. Then hell broke loose in the neck muscle expanding to a 2-3” wound channel completely snapping the spine then turning the off side shoulder into mush. Bullet was lodged in the center of the heavy shoulder muscle. I realize this is a high speed impact but I am impressed the core and jacket still held together. Not a great test but off to a good start. I will get bullet pics and weights soon. Off to bed with an early wake up for the morning hunt!
